  1. // SPDX-License-Identifier: GPL-2.0-only
  2. /*
  3. * Copyright (c) 2019, The Linux Foundation. All rights reserved.
  4. */
  5. #include <linux/interconnect.h>
  6. #include "cam_soc_bus.h"
  7. /**
  8. * struct cam_soc_bus_client_data : Bus client data
  9. *
  10. * @icc_data: Bus icc path information
  11. */
  12. struct cam_soc_bus_client_data {
  13. struct icc_path *icc_data;
  14. };
  15. int cam_soc_bus_client_update_request(void *client, unsigned int idx)
  16. {
  17. int rc = 0;
  18. uint64_t ab = 0, ib = 0;
  19. struct cam_soc_bus_client *bus_client =
  20. (struct cam_soc_bus_client *) client;
  21. struct cam_soc_bus_client_data *bus_client_data =
  22. (struct cam_soc_bus_client_data *) bus_client->client_data;
  23. if (idx >= bus_client->common_data->num_usecases) {
  24. CAM_ERR(CAM_UTIL, "Invalid vote level=%d, usecases=%d", idx,
  25. bus_client->common_data->num_usecases);
  26. rc = -EINVAL;
  27. goto end;
  28. }
  29. ab = bus_client->common_data->bw_pair[idx].ab;
  30. ib = bus_client->common_data->bw_pair[idx].ib;
  31. CAM_DBG(CAM_UTIL, "Bus client=[%s] index[%d]",
  32. bus_client->common_data->name, idx);
  33. rc = icc_set_bw(bus_client_data->icc_data, ab, ib);
  34. if (rc) {
  35. CAM_ERR(CAM_UTIL,
  36. "Update request failed, client[%s], idx: %d",
  37. bus_client->common_data->name, idx);
  38. goto end;
  39. }
  40. end:
  41. return rc;
  42. }
  43. int cam_soc_bus_client_update_bw(void *client, uint64_t ab, uint64_t ib)
  44. {
  45. struct cam_soc_bus_client *bus_client =
  46. (struct cam_soc_bus_client *) client;
  47. struct cam_soc_bus_client_data *bus_client_data =
  48. (struct cam_soc_bus_client_data *) bus_client->client_data;
  49. int rc = 0;
  50. CAM_DBG(CAM_UTIL, "Bus client=[%s] :ab[%llu] ib[%llu]",
  51. bus_client->common_data->name, ab, ib);
  52. rc = icc_set_bw(bus_client_data->icc_data, ab, ib);
  53. if (rc) {
  54. CAM_ERR(CAM_UTIL, "Update request failed, client[%s]",
  55. bus_client->common_data->name);
  56. goto end;
  57. }
  58. end:
  59. return rc;
  60. }
  61. int cam_soc_bus_client_register(struct platform_device *pdev,
  62. struct device_node *dev_node, void **client,
  63. struct cam_soc_bus_client_common_data *common_data)
  64. {
  65. struct cam_soc_bus_client *bus_client = NULL;
  66. struct cam_soc_bus_client_data *bus_client_data = NULL;
  67. int rc = 0;
  68. bus_client = kzalloc(sizeof(struct cam_soc_bus_client), GFP_KERNEL);
  69. if (!bus_client) {
  70. CAM_ERR(CAM_UTIL, "soc bus client is NULL");
  71. rc = -ENOMEM;
  72. goto end;
  73. }
  74. *client = bus_client;
  75. bus_client_data = kzalloc(sizeof(struct cam_soc_bus_client_data),
  76. GFP_KERNEL);
  77. if (!bus_client_data) {
  78. kfree(bus_client);
  79. *client = NULL;
  80. rc = -ENOMEM;
  81. goto end;
  82. }
  83. bus_client->client_data = bus_client_data;
  84. bus_client->common_data = common_data;
  85. bus_client_data->icc_data = icc_get(&pdev->dev,
  86. bus_client->common_data->src_id,
  87. bus_client->common_data->dst_id);
  88. if (!bus_client_data->icc_data) {
  89. CAM_ERR(CAM_UTIL, "failed in register bus client");
  90. rc = -EINVAL;
  91. goto error;
  92. }
  93. rc = icc_set_bw(bus_client_data->icc_data, 0, 0);
  94. if (rc) {
  95. CAM_ERR(CAM_UTIL, "Bus client update request failed, rc = %d",
  96. rc);
  97. goto fail_unregister_client;
  98. }
  99. CAM_DBG(CAM_UTIL, "Bus Client=[%s] : src=%d, dst=%d",
  100. bus_client->common_data->name, bus_client->common_data->src_id,
  101. bus_client->common_data->dst_id);
  102. return 0;
  103. fail_unregister_client:
  104. icc_put(bus_client_data->icc_data);
  105. error:
  106. kfree(bus_client_data);
  107. bus_client->client_data = NULL;
  108. kfree(bus_client);
  109. *client = NULL;
  110. end:
  111. return rc;
  112. }
  113. void cam_soc_bus_client_unregister(void **client)
  114. {
  115. struct cam_soc_bus_client *bus_client =
  116. (struct cam_soc_bus_client *) (*client);
  117. struct cam_soc_bus_client_data *bus_client_data =
  118. (struct cam_soc_bus_client_data *) bus_client->client_data;
  119. icc_put(bus_client_data->icc_data);
  120. kfree(bus_client_data);
  121. bus_client->client_data = NULL;
  122. kfree(bus_client);
  123. *client = NULL;
  124. }
